[EMAIL PROTECTED] changed: What |Removed |Added ---------------------------------------------------------------------------- Status|NEW |ASSIGNED ------- Comment #2 from [EMAIL PROTECTED] 2008-07-15 18:46 ------- Experience has shown that different Fujitsu laptops use incompatible ways of controlling the brightness via software. The fujitsu-laptop module in 2.6.25 knew of the method required by the S7020 and *some* other S-series laptops. However, this did not work for the S6410 (for example), among others. Thanks to the work and debugging efforts of an S6410 user, 2.6.27 will have support for the brightness control method used on the S6410. It is however impossible to know which other Fujitsu models this new method will work with. We'll just have to try it and see. It will most likely work with some other S-series laptops. This bug report does not relate to an S-series laptop, so the best I can say is that the new code may work - I certainly can't guarantee it at this stage. Therefore in the first instance I would ask that you try kernel 2.6.27-rc1 when it is released and report what - if anything - has changed. If 2.6.27-rc1 still doesn't work it indicates that your Fujitsu laptop uses yet another method for controlling the LCD brightness via software.
